Need to search information about court cases in Cuyahoga County? You can efficiently access the judicial filings online. The Cuyahoga County Court website makes available a searchable database of court files. To start your search, you'll need the case number or the names involved in the matter.

Once you have this information, you can submit it into the digital portal. The system will then present all relevant files associated with that legal proceeding.

Retrieve Cuyahoga County Court Documents Online

Need to access court documents related to a case in Cuyahoga County? You're in luck! The clerk's office offers an online platform that allows you to search records electronically. This accessible tool can save you time and effort compared to visiting the courthouse in person. To get started, you'll need to navigate to the official platform for Cuyahoga County Court Records. Once there, you can input case information such as parties and dates. The system will then present a list of relevant documents that are available for examination.

Keep in mind that some records may be sealed due to privacy concerns or other legal reasons.
